Lifeline Theatre brings to Chicago Alexandre Dumas' 'The Three Musketeers', adapted by ensemble member Robert Kauzlaric. Originally commissioned by the Illinois Shakespeare Festival in 2010, it's been further developed for its Chicago premiere at Lifeline. Fourteen actors play the more-than 50 roles...

Moira is as tall as two women, so it's only fitting that she will be playing two women in our production. She has been understudying both Lady Macbeth, who she will play this Friday (Oct 26), and Lady Macduff, who she will play next Friday (Nov 2).

Bio: Moira Begale has had a wonderful time with TheMASSIVE and is so lucky to be a part of such a wonderful team. She was most recently seen playing Devon in Chicago Pride Series and Plays' The All-American GenderF*ck, LaFontaine in WildClaw Theatre's Carmilla and Jocasta/Tisiphone in Babes with Blades' The Last Daughter of Oedipus. Acting in Chicago for 5 years, Moira has worked with many companies including: Remy Bumppo, Bare B***d, Redmoon Theater, New Leaf Theater, Dream Theater, Angel Island Theater, Saint Sebastian Players and Theater Building Chicago. A graduate of Illinois State University with a double major in Theater/Acting and Theater Management, Moira has also studied with Black Box Acting Studio.
